...Searching for a good new challenge, which I found within the human female shapes, nothing else I'd
created was this difficult.
The body of a woman has many lines and structures to explore. Before I put the
first lines on paper I have no idea what the end results will be.
While working out the shapes and shades
the eyes are the most important subject! If the look of the eyes fail the drawing is ruined. I can't let
this happen to these creatures... |
Works are made on
160 grams 320 x 480mm paper.
Some portraits on
160 grams 240 x 320mm paper. |
